Refinancing Loans

At Summit Lending, we specialize in helping residents of Union City, California, refinance their existing mortgages to better suit their financial needs. Visit our dedicated page for Refinance Loans in Union City, California to explore your options.

Refinancing can offer several potential benefits, such as securing a lower interest rate, which may reduce your monthly payments and save you money over the life of the loan. You might also change loan terms, for example, switching from an adjustable-rate mortgage to a fixed-rate one for more predictable payments. Other advantages include accessing cash from your home's equity or shortening your loan term to pay off your mortgage faster. Construction Loans

At Summit Lending, we specialize in construction loans designed to help you finance the building or renovating of properties in Union City, California. These loans are ideal for new construction projects, allowing you to secure funding for turning your vision into reality. How these loans work for new construction projects: A typical construction loan from Summit Lending combines the construction phase with permanent financing into a single, streamlined process known as a construction-to-permanent loan. This means you can borrow funds to cover the costs of building your home or property, with the loan converting to a traditional mortgage once construction is complete. Regarding funding disbursements during the construction phase: Funds are typically disbursed in stages, often referred to as "draws," based on the progress of your project. This interest-only payment structure during construction helps manage cash flow, with disbursements made after inspections confirm milestones are met. When considering a commercial loan application, several key factors should be evaluated to increase your chances of approval. These include your business's financial stability, such as cash flow and credit history, the appraised value of the property, required down payments, and the overall market conditions in Union City. Which home loan is right for me?

Your ideal loan depends on several factors like your financial situation, long term goals, and risk tolerance. Fixed rate mortgages offer stability, while adjustable rate loans may save you money initially. Government-backed options can be great for those with lower credit scores.
